Staff Accountant [CLOSED]

Reports To

Controller

Job Purpose

This position is responsible for preparing journal entries, account reconciliation, bank reconciliation as well as documenting and evaluating current procedures. The main areas of focus include general accounting, fixed assets, and account analysis. The staff accountant will also assist the controller with the maintenance of the accounting system (Intacct).


Job Summary / Responsibilities

  • Prepare month-end closing journal entries (e.g. expense accruals, revenue accruals, straight line rent adjustments, and etc.).
  • Responsible for fixed assets capitalization and depreciation.
  • Prepare monthly bank reconciliations.
  • Review monthly credit card activities and prepare journal entries.
  • Assist with the maintenance of the accounting system.
  • Assist with electronic documentation of accounts payable and expense report.
  • Assist with the maintenance of the general ledger.
  • Assist with month-end and year-end reporting.
  • Assist with the annual audit and preparation of financial statements under GAAP for Not-for- Profit organizations.
  • Assist with the preparation and filing of the annual Form 1099.
  • Assist with continuous improvement of processes.
  • Additional duties as required.


Required Qualifications

  • B.A. degree in accounting or finance from a four-year college or university.
  • Minimum of 3 years progressively accounting experience with knowledge of sub-ledger, GL debit & credit, financial reports, etc.
  • Knowledge of GAAP for Not-for-Profit organizations.
  • Strong communication skills, including verbal and written.
  • Ability to effectively communicate to all levels of the organization.
  • Ability to manage multiple competing tasks and meet established deadlines.
  • Ability to work as part of an integrated team as well as independently.
  • Ability to work in an open, transparent, and collaborative environment.
  • Strong attention to details.
  • Strong Excel skills.
  • Ability to work well with people with a very wide diversity of demographic and cultural characteristics.
